Uses of Class
io.atomix.raft.protocol.TransferRequest
Packages that use TransferRequest
Package
Description
Raft partition management utilities.
Provides
RaftRequest and RaftResponse implementations for all internal Raft protocol
communication.Provides classes for role-based management of leader election and replication in the Raft
consensus protocol.
-
Uses of TransferRequest in io.atomix.raft.partition.impl
Methods in io.atomix.raft.partition.impl with parameters of type TransferRequestModifier and TypeMethodDescriptionRaftServerCommunicator.transfer(MemberId memberId, TransferRequest request) Method parameters in io.atomix.raft.partition.impl with type arguments of type TransferRequestModifier and TypeMethodDescriptionvoidRaftServerCommunicator.registerTransferHandler(Function<TransferRequest, CompletableFuture<TransferResponse>> handler) -
Uses of TransferRequest in io.atomix.raft.protocol
Methods in io.atomix.raft.protocol that return TransferRequestMethods in io.atomix.raft.protocol with parameters of type TransferRequestModifier and TypeMethodDescriptionRaftServerProtocol.transfer(MemberId memberId, TransferRequest request) Sends a transfer request to the given node.Method parameters in io.atomix.raft.protocol with type arguments of type TransferRequestModifier and TypeMethodDescriptionvoidRaftServerProtocol.registerTransferHandler(Function<TransferRequest, CompletableFuture<TransferResponse>> handler) Registers a transfer request callback. -
Uses of TransferRequest in io.atomix.raft.roles
Methods in io.atomix.raft.roles with parameters of type TransferRequestModifier and TypeMethodDescriptionInactiveRole.onTransfer(TransferRequest request) LeaderRole.onTransfer(TransferRequest request) RaftRole.onTransfer(TransferRequest request) Handles a transfer request.